Course Content

• Body Image and Self-Esteem: Exploring the psychological foundations of body image and the impact of societal pressures.
• Body Modification Practices: A comprehensive overview of various body modification techniques, including tattooing, piercing, and scarification, with a focus on safety and hygiene.
• The History and Culture of Body Modification: Examining the historical and cross-cultural significance of body modification across different societies and time periods.
• Body Image in Media and Popular Culture: Analyzing the portrayal of body image in media, its influence on self-perception, and the perpetuation of unrealistic beauty standards.
• Ethics and Consent in Body Modification: A detailed exploration of ethical considerations, informed consent, and responsible practices within the body modification industry.
• Aftercare and Healing: Comprehensive guidance on proper aftercare procedures for various body modifications, minimizing risks and promoting healthy healing.
• Body Modification and Identity: Understanding how body modification can be used as a form of self-expression, identity creation, and cultural affiliation.
• Risk Management and Infection Control in Body Modification: Focus on minimizing health risks and preventing infections in body modification procedures, including proper sterilization techniques.
• Professionalism and Business Practices in Body Modification: Developing essential business skills, client communication, and ethical conduct for body modification professionals.

Career path

Career Paths in Body Image & Modification (UK)

Role Description
Body Piercer Expert in piercing techniques, hygiene, and aftercare; high demand for skilled professionals with advanced certifications.
Tattoo Artist Creates bespoke tattoo designs and executes them with precision and artistry; strong portfolio and client management skills essential.
Cosmetic Tattooist Specializes in permanent makeup and other cosmetic tattooing; requires advanced training and a keen eye for detail.
Body Modification Specialist Provides a range of body modification services, including scarification and branding; in-depth knowledge of hygiene and safety protocols crucial.
Body Image Therapist Helps individuals develop a positive body image and address body image concerns; strong therapeutic skills and empathy required.
